#54918b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54918b is composed of 32.9% red, 56.9%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.1%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 174.1 degrees, a saturation of 26.6% and a lightness of 44.9%. #54918b color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#002317.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#54918b color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
#54918b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54918b has RGB values of R:84, G:145,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 5542283.

Shades and Tints of #54918b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050808 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#54918b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7776 is the less saturated color, while #05e0cb is the most saturated one.
